Financial Need. QuestBridge finalists generally come from households earning less than $65,000 a year for a family of four. This includes all sources of family income, including rental income, retirement distributions, and child support. Early Admission with a full scholarship!*. *With a second chance of admission through …FAFSA EFC is completely irrelevant only the school EFC matters. e.g. Yale only matched to 0 EFC but for Yale, anyone w/ an income <$75k has an EFC of 0. EFC also varies by school. At Brown, according to the NPC, my EFC is $8000 because my family owns a home. at Rice the NPC says it is $800. my FAFSA EFC is 3.1k. 48.for anyone wondering about percentages for Questbridge in general, the acceptance rates for QB have been pretty consistent thoughout the years with around 36-38% of applicants becoming finalists, and then out of that pool around 18-21% get matched. This doesn't include students who are accepted for RD, but overall those are some very slim ...

I've been STARING at my iPad for about 4 hours at this point and now I'm losing my mind. Look at the range of colleges on the Questbridge site and don't get fixated on the top 20 ranking. QB has 40 college partners and they may add more next year. There are a lot of liberal arts colleges on the list where you will get a solid education and graduate with excellent job prospects, but without the Big Name.

Turns out I uploaded our taxes directly from our accountant and it had a digital signature. IDOC requires a hand written signature. I had to print out all the pages of our taxes, sign them and then scan them in to upload them to IDOC.
